by Peter Gallway (Author)

In Hardtail Strat: Guitars, Heroin, Song, and Stories, Peter Gallway traces his coming of age in the electric pulse of Greenwich Village's 1960s music revolution. From shooting rubber bands in Arthur Miller and Marilyn Monroe's Sutton Place apartment to shooting heroin in the backrooms of New York, Gallway plunges into the intoxicating world of the Night Owl Café alongside the Lovin' Spoonful and James Taylor, through the Troubadour, Mama Cass, the Manson family, and the record companies of LA's Sunset Strip-until the road leads to Tokyo, and finally Maine, where a Fender "hardtail" Stratocaster guitar leads to an unlikely rebirth.

Written in the raw, lyrical rhythm of a songwriter who "thinks in stanzas," Hardtail Strat is a story of music and madness, abuse and opportunity, loss and redemption-and the enduring power of song to set us free.A Hard Day's Night hits the theaters.We go to the opening.How can you not want to feel like that?Free.
